site stats

Std flush in c

WebMar 29, 2015 · For example snippet below deadlocks currently and will deadlock in all the same cases if we made it to auto-flush. let output = io ::stdout(); let output = output.lock(); print!("stdout locked"); // deadlock. I’m starting to believe that stabilising Std {in,out,err}::lock was a wrong and hasty move. 2 Member alexcrichton commented on Mar 30, 2015 Webstd::basic_ostream& flush( std::basic_ostream& os ); Flushes the output sequence os as if by calling os.flush(). This is an output-only I/O manipulator, it may be called with an expression such as out << std::flush for any out of type … default precision: 6 maximum precision: 19 precision: pi: 0 3 1 3 2 3.1 3 3.14 4 3.142 …

endl - cplusplus.com

WebDescription The C library function int fflush (FILE *stream) flushes the output buffer of a stream. Declaration Following is the declaration for fflush () function. int fflush(FILE … WebOct 30, 2024 · Using “ fflush (stdin) ”: Typing “fflush (stdin)” after “scanf ()” statement, also clears the input buffer but generally it’s use is avoided and is termed to be “undefined” for input stream as per the C++11 standards. In the case of C++: 1. door knocking knuckles in baseball https://joshtirey.com

What does buffer flush means in C++ - GeeksForGeeks

WebJan 6, 2016 · Basically, number is an int type variable and it is only designed to store an integer. Once user enters a non-integer such as 'q', cin enters the "failed state" and input operations are no longer possible unless you terminate the program or you somehow correct it and force cin out of the failed state. That is when you use "cin.clear ()". WebJun 22, 2024 · Use of fflush (stdin) in C. fflush () is typically used for output stream only. Its purpose is to clear (or flush) the output buffer and move the buffered data to console (in … WebJan 24, 2024 · std::endl writes a newline to the output stream and flushes it. In most cases, the developer doesn’t need to flush. Flushing operation is expensive, because it involves a system call. Instead... city of marlborough building department

std::endl vs n in C++ - GeeksforGeeks

Category:C++ fflush() - C++ Standard Library - Programiz

Tags:Std flush in c

Std flush in c

std::flush - cppreference.com

WebDec 31, 2012 · The std::ostream::flush () function technically calls std::streambuf::pubsync () on the stream buffer (if any) which is associated with the stream: The stream buffer is … WebYou can do this either directly by invoking the flush () method or through the std::flush stream manipulator: std::ofstream os ("foo.txt"); os << "Hello World!" << std::flush; char data [3] = "Foo"; os.write (data, 3); os.flush (); There is a stream manipulator std::endl that combines writing a newline with flushing the stream:

Std flush in c

Did you know?

WebApr 12, 2024 · C++ : Does std::endl std::flush have a purpose?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"So here is a secret hidden ... WebMar 23, 2024 · std::flush 是C++标准库 中的一个操作符,用于刷新输出流。刷新输出流表示将缓冲区中的数据立即发送到关联的输出设备(例如屏幕或文件)。在某些情况下,输出流会自动刷新,例如当流缓冲区满时,但使用 std::flush 可以强制立即刷新缓冲区。 ...

WebJan 5, 2024 · std::osyncstream is a useful and much needed feature in C++ that fills the gap in multi-threading and stream buffers. This will, in my opinion make logging features seamlessly easy in C++... Webstd:: ostream ::flush ostream& flush (); Flush output stream buffer Synchronizes the associated stream buffer with its controlled output sequence. For stream buffer objects …

WebMar 19, 2024 · In summary, using std::endl in C++ will flush the output buffer and write the data to the output device immediately, while using \n will not flush the output buffer until it is necessary or manually triggered. Example 1: We can use std::endl in C++ but not in C. So std::endl runs well in C++ but if we use C, it runs error. C++ C #include WebYou can do this either directly by invoking the flush () method or through the std::flush stream manipulator: std::ofstream os ("foo.txt"); os << "Hello World!" << std::flush; char …

Webstd:: endl Insert newline and flush Inserts a new-line character and flushes the stream. Its behavior is equivalent to calling os.put ('\n') (or os.put ( os.widen ('\n')) for character types other than char ), and then os.flush (). Parameters os Output stream object affected. doorlag realty companyWebstd:: fflush. For output streams (and for update streams on which the last operation was output), writes any unwritten data from the stream 's buffer to the associated output … door knocking scripts real estate agentWebstd:: ostream ::flush ostream& flush (); Flush output stream buffer Synchronizes the associated stream buffer with its controlled output sequence. For stream buffer objects that implement intermediate buffers, this function requests all characters to be written to the controlled sequence. door knock notification bienchenWebOutput flushing: flush. endl. flush_emit (C++20) unitbuf nounitbuf. emit_on_flush noemit_on_flush (C++20) (C++20) Status flags manipulation: resetiosflags. ... when the associated output buffer needs to be null-terminated to be processed as a C string. Unlike std::endl, this manipulator does not flush the stream. Parameters. os - reference to ... door latch 57mm backsetWebstd:: fflush C++ Input/output library C-style I/O Defined in header int fflush( std::FILE* stream ); For output streams (and for update streams on which the last operation was output), writes any unwritten data from the stream 's … city of marlborough ma bill payWebFeb 14, 2024 · This article will demonstrate multiple methods about how to flush the stdout output stream in C. Use the fflush Function to Flush stdout Output Stream in C C standard library provides an I/O library, stdio, that essentially represents a buffered version of I/O operations done in userspace, thus improving performance for common use-cases. door knocking script real estateWebFeb 14, 2024 · This article will demonstrate multiple methods about how to flush the stdout output stream in C. Use the fflush Function to Flush stdout Output Stream in C C standard … do orlando have a beach